What Are Seconds And Weeks?

What Is A Second?

Second (s) is the base unit of time in the SI system. It is defined as the duration of 9,192,631,770 periods of the radiation corresponding to the transition between two hyperfine levels of cesium-133. Symbol: s. Example: light travels about 299,792 kilometers in one second, showing how far light moves in a unit of time.

What Is A Week?

Week: a unit of time equal to seven days. In SI terms, 1 week = 7 days = 604,800 seconds. It is a calendar/time unit (not an SI base unit, but accepted with SI). Symbol: wk. Real-world example: a calendar week runs from Monday to Sunday, comprising seven days.

History & Context

Timekeeping began with simple marks from the sun and water clocks, and people measured moments as day turned to night; the second grew from the idea of a small fraction of the day and later became a precise standard based on atomic events, today tied to the vibrations of atoms and used by clocks and watches worldwide. The week arose in ancient cultures as a repeating cycle of days tied to work, rest, and religious observance, and it spread through Mesopotamia, the Hebrew tradition, the Roman world, and medieval Europe, becoming a familiar schedule for farming, markets, and worship across many societies.
